Summary

Leviticus 4 focuses on the instructions for, and meaning of, the so-called “sin offering” of the OT sacrificial system. In this episode, we talk about how the translation “sin offering” is misleading, due to how Christians naturally filter OT sacrificial talk through what happened on the cross. The episode discusses what the “sin offering” really meant and accomplished (or not).
